A Natural Way To Relieve Fibromyalgia By Matt Ream Natural remedies to diseases and conditions have been around for thousands of years, much longer than the conventional medicines that have been developed in the last century. Despite such advances in the medical pharmaceutical industry, many of these medicines come with an expensive consequence such as serious side effects, dangerous drug interactions and addiction. As a result, many have turned to the more natural way of treating their illnesses such as sufferers from Fibromyalgia have done. Fibromyalgia is a chronic illness that most commonly affects the shoulders, neck, back, pelvic girdle and hands, as well as other areas of the body.
Developing proper sleeping habits is one of the best ways to gain a natural remedy for Fibromyalgia. This includes going to bed and getting up at the same time each day, making sure that the sleep area is free from distractions and is a comfortable temperature. In addition, avoiding caffeine will also help individuals to fall asleep better, as will doing light exercise throughout the day and practicing relaxation techniques. In extreme cases, sleep medications may be prescribed. Patients are urged to carefully consider the use of any medication that is addictive, which is often the case with sleep inducing medication.
Emotional support from friends and family members is a very effective natural remedy for Fibromyalgia. Chronic illnesses often pose
serious challenges for most people, not just on a physical level but psychologically and emotionally as well. Opening lines of communication within one's support system of family and friends is proven to have a positive effect on relieving individuals with Fibromyalgia. There are many support groups across the country that were created for those with the same condition to share and validate their experiences.
In addition to the aforementioned options used as a natural remedy for Fibromyalgia, many individuals find that physical therapy, massages, light aerobics, the application of heat or cold, yoga, relaxation exercises, aromatherapy, breathing techniques and nutritional supplements may help to ease their discomfort.
A natural remedy for Fibromyalgia, combined with some type of medical treatment and/or intervention, is believed to offer the patient a better quality of life and overall improved prognosis. Individuals are not urged to rely on a natural remedy for Fibromyalgia alone, but rather a combination that allows them to not be completely dependant on any one treatment regimen.

Chronic syndrome with symptoms including varied, pervasive muscle aches, stiffness, profound fatigue, soft tissue tenderness, and sleep disorder. Pain can occur anywhere in the body and ranges from mild to intense. Many medical professionals believe that a connection exists between fibromyalgia and chronic fatigue syndrome; some even theorize that they are actually the same syndrome.
